The video discusses an athlete's unique style and strong camera presence, comparing her with a more reserved Japanese competitor. It highlights her focus and preparation, race strategy, and execution during a preliminary race. The narrative explores the balance between humility and confidence, emphasizing the athlete's talent and potential. It anticipates her performance in future competitions, including the Olympics, drawing parallels to past successful athletes like Liu Xiang.
